CcHUB launches Design Lab Fellowship in Kigali

The Fellowship will feature courses and projects aimed at incorporating human-centered design (HCD) thinking – a framework that involves human perspectives in all steps of the problem-solving process – into how public agencies and corporate organizations solve problems, according to CcHUB.
